Post by: Reaver on <10-30-11/0226:39>
Been laying the ground work for tomarrows game for weeks :D

The villain is a matrix and drone expert that specializes in emotitoy weapons delivery :p ( auto injectors for poisons, turning them into dancing bombs, etc)  he likes to strike in public places where other emotitoys could be found. He then hacks into them ALL and sings a children's nursery rhyme, twisting it hint at what is coming...
All they know so far is his Tag: Jack O'hallow.

Got 2 of the team so spooked out, they are paranoid about going ANYWHERE the freaking things might be :p
